reciprocal consideration
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"reciprocal consideration"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ts involving mutual respect or exchange of value between parties, often in legal or business discussions. Example: "In our agreement, both parties must ensure reciprocal consideration to maintain a fair partnership."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"reciprocal consideration", ensure the context clearly indicates that both parties are actively involved in a mutual exchange or recognition. Use it in situations where there's a clear give-and-take dynamic, such as negotiations or partnership agreements.
Common error
Avoid using "reciprocal consideration" when only one party is showing consideration or taking action. The phrase implies a two-way street, so ensure both sides are actively participating in the exchange.

FAQs
How can I use "reciprocal consideration" in a sentence?
You can use "reciprocal consideration" to describe situations where there's a mutual exchange of value or respect between parties. For example: "The contract requires "reciprocal consideration" from both the buyer and the seller".
What's the difference between "reciprocal consideration" and "mutual consideration"?
"Reciprocal consideration" and "mutual consideration" are quite similar; both imply that each party is providing something of value. "Reciprocal" emphasizes the exchange aspect, whereas "mutual" simply highlights the shared nature of the consideration. In most contexts, they are interchangeable.
What can I say instead of "reciprocal consideration"?
Alternatives to "reciprocal consideration" include "mutual respect", "balanced exchange", or "give-and-take", depending on the specific nuance you wish to convey.
Is "reciprocal consideration" a legal term?
While not exclusively a legal term, "reciprocal consideration" is often used in legal and business contexts to describe the mutual obligations and benefits exchanged in a contract or agreement. It underscores the idea that both parties are providing something of value to the other.
